jenkins如何和git关联
-
Jenkins是一个流行的开源持续集成工具,而Git是一个常用的分布式版本控制系统。将Jenkins与Git关联可以实现自动化构建和部署,提高软件开发过程的效率和质量。下面将介绍如何将Jenkins与Git关联。
首先,确保你已经在系统中安装了Jenkins和Git。如果没有安装,可以去官方网站下载安装包并按照指导进行安装。
1. 在Jenkins中安装Git插件:在Jenkins的插件管理页面搜索“git”,找到Git插件并进行安装。安装完毕后,重启Jenkins服务。
2. 在Jenkins中配置Git仓库信息:进入Jenkins的系统管理页面,在全局工具配置中找到Git并进行相应的配置。配置包括Git的路径、用户名和邮箱等信息。
3. 在Jenkins中创建一个新的任务:点击Jenkins首页上的“新建项”按钮,选择自由风格的软件项目,并为项目命名。
4. 在任务配置中关联Git仓库:在任务的配置页面,找到“源码管理”部分,选择Git。输入Git仓库的URL,并填写认证信息(如有需要)。可以选择分支和标签等具体配置项。
5. 设置触发构建:在任务配置页面的“触发器”部分,可以设置何时触发构建。常见的有定时构建、轮询构建和触发器构建等方式。
6. 设置构建步骤:在任务配置页面的“构建”部分,可以添加构建步骤,如编译代码、运行测试、生成文档等。根据具体的项目需求进行配置。
7. 保存配置并运行任务:点击保存按钮保存配置,并点击立即构建按钮运行任务。Jenkins会自动从关联的Git仓库中拉取代码,并执行配置的构建步骤。
通过上述步骤,你已经成功将Jenkins与Git关联起来了。当Git仓库中的代码有更新时,Jenkins会自动进行构建,并执行相应的操作。这样可以实现自动化的软件开发流程,提高开发效率和质量。
2年前 -
要将Jenkins与Git关联,您可以按照以下步骤进行操作:
1. 安装Jenkins:首先,您需要在系统上安装Jenkins。根据您的操作系统,您可以选择从Jenkins官方网站上下载适合您环境的安装包,然后按照安装指南进行安装。
2. 安装Git插件:在Jenkins安装完成后,您需要安装Git插件,以便与Git进行集成。要安装Git插件,请在Jenkins的管理页面中选择“插件管理”选项,并在可选插件列表中搜索“Git”。选择Git插件并点击安装。
3. 配置全局Git设置:在Jenkins的管理页面中,选择“系统设置”选项,然后找到“Git”部分。在这里,您可以配置全局的Git设置,包括Git可执行文件路径和用户全局配置。
4. 创建Jenkins项目:在Jenkins的主界面上,单击“新建项目”来创建一个新的Jenkins项目。在配置项目的页面上,您可以配置项目名称、描述和其他选项。在“源代码管理”部分,选择“Git”,然后提供Git存储库的URL。
5. 配置Git存储库:在配置项目页面的“源代码管理”部分,提供您Git存储库的URL,并选择所需的分支或标签。您还可以选择设置轮询SCM以定期检查Git存储库的更改。
6. 配置构建触发器:在配置项目页面的“构建触发器”部分,您可以选择当发生特定事件时触发构建,如提交到Git存储库、定期调度、或通过其他外部触发器。
7. 配置构建步骤:在配置项目页面的“构建”部分,您可以定义要在构建过程中执行的步骤。您可以使用Shell脚本、构建脚本、构建工具等来构建您的项目。例如,您可以使用Maven或Gradle来构建Java项目。
8. 保存并运行项目:完成配置后,保存项目配置并开始执行构建。Jenkins将定期轮询Git存储库,检查是否有新的提交,并根据您的配置触发构建。
通过这些步骤,您可以将Jenkins与Git成功关联,实现持续集成和自动化构建。每当有新的提交到Git存储库时,Jenkins将自动触发构建并执行所需的步骤。这将大大简化您的开发流程,并确保代码的质量和稳定性。
2年前 -
Jenkins 是一个开源的持续集成工具,可以与 Git 集成以实现自动化构建和部署。下面是将 Jenkins 和 Git 关联的方法和操作流程。
1. 安装和配置 Jenkins
首先,需要在服务器上安装和配置 Jenkins。可以从官方网站 https://jenkins.io 下载适用于您操作系统的安装程序,并按照说明进行安装。2. 创建一个新的 Jenkins 作业
打开 Jenkins 控制台,在左侧导航栏中选择“新建项”。在弹出的界面上,输入作业名称,并选择“自由风格软件项目”类型。3. 配置 Git 仓库
在作业配置页面的“源码管理”部分,选择 Git 作为源码管理工具。然后,填写 Git 仓库的 URL,如 https://github.com/example/example.git。如果您的 Git 仓库需要认证,可以选择“凭据”选项,然后在下拉菜单中选择或创建适当的凭据。
4. 配置构建触发器
在作业配置页面的“构建触发器”部分,可以选择不同的构建触发方式。最常用的方式是配置轮询 SCM,即定期检查仓库的变化。可以选择在 SVN 或 Git 中配置轮询规则。5. 配置构建步骤
在作业配置页面的“构建”部分,选择构建步骤以定义构建过程。可以执行多个构建步骤,例如构建代码、运行测试和打包等。对于与 Git 关联的作业,常见的构建步骤包括拉取代码、检出特定分支或标签、构建项目和部署到服务器等。
6. 保存和启动作业
完成作业的配置后,点击“保存”按钮保存配置。然后点击“立即构建”按钮来手动触发一次构建,或者等待轮询触发构建。Jenkins 将从 Git 仓库拉取新的代码并执行构建步骤。7. 查看构建结果和日志
在 Jenkins 控制台的作业页面上,您可以查看构建历史记录、构建结果和构建日志。如果构建失败,可以查看日志以了解详细的错误信息。通过上述步骤,您可以成功地将 Jenkins 和 Git 关联起来,实现自动化构建和部署。您可以根据需要添加更多的构建步骤或配置其他 Jenkins 插件来满足您的需求。
2年前